APPROVAL OF THE WRITTEN PROCEDURES GOVERNING THE SHELTERED MARKET PROGRAM (SMP)

NOTICE TO THE PUBLIC OF THE APPROVAL OF THE WRITTEN PROCEDURES GOVERNING THE SHELTERED MARKET PROGRAM (SMP) BY THE BOSTON WATER AND SEWER COMMISSION

The Boston Water and Sewer Commission held a public hearing on Thursday, May 9, 2024, for the purpose of giving interested persons an opportunity to present data, views or arguments relative to the establishment of the Sheltered Market Program (SMP). At that meeting, the written procedures governing the SMP was presented and thereafter, the procedure was adopted by the Commission.

SHELTERED MARKET PROGRAM

Following the findings of the Disparity Study conducted by BBC Research & Consulting in 2020, the Commission developed a Sheltered Market Program (SMP) to address the disparities in the use of minority-owned business enterprises (MBEs) and women-owned business enterprises (WBEs) in government contracting. Information about Commission contracts designated for the SMP, the Commission’s SMP procedures, and how to bid on SMP procurements is available at bwsc.org.
